Error logs are typically quite easy to configure. This would still require a custom solution for removal of older files, but lets devops manage timeframes for each log file precisely.

If the special value syslog is used, the errors are sent to the system logger instead.

I found this post in a forum concerning your question: "Use set_error_handler('myErrorFunction'); (See PHP Manual set_error_handler) define myErrorFunction with database inserts, turn off standard error reporting display with ini_get('display_errors', 0);" (How Php.ini Error Log The Debug Log Another convenient thing about nginx logs is the debug log. You can specify in the php.ini what file to store all errors in. Fighting Log File Bloat Since log files are text files to which you always append information, they are constantly growing.

The file should be writable by the web server's user. Php Debug Log Is there any other way I can find the error log on shared hosting environment instead of having to go through entire site structure to look for error_log files? Here’s a simple example of how to write to the log:

Php.ini Error Log

i dont knw how to handle this? http://askubuntu.com/questions/14763/where-are-the-apache-and-php-log-files date("Ymd.H") . ".audit.log";
$fp = fopen($path ,"a");
$usr = $_SESSION["name"];

Other Logs Worth Mentioning Two other PHP logs worth mentioning are the debug log and data storage log. my review here Let’s see a simple configuration file for rotating our logs: /var/log/my/debug.log /var/log/my/info.log /var/log/my/warning.log /var/log/my/error.log { rotate 7 daily missingok notifempty delaycompress compress sharedscripts postrotate invoke-rc.d rsyslog rotate > /dev/null endscript } number of errors in Apache error log and draw trends over time, in order to predict e.g. for example, you say: Open /etc/php.ini fileI wish someone would write an article that said what that is and where to find it!ReplyLinkCasey ArnoldJuly 9, 2015, 8:05 pmYou can easily find Php Error Log Windows

Moreover, that analysis can often be performed with standard Linux command line tools like grep, sed, or awk.

Select Only Printed Out Cells How common is the usage of yous as a plural of you? Php Log_errors For more information about the error_log directive, please visit https://secure.php.net/manual/en/errorfunc.configuration.php#ini.error-log. In this case it is a relative path, which means it will be under /etc/httpd/logs/error_log.

share|improve this answer edited Apr 19 '12 at 9:00 Community♦ 1 answered Nov 24 '10 at 19:18 misterben 3,94321523 Yep. Where will I be able to find php logs?ReplyLinknixCraftJune 15, 2010, 1:50 pmSame location which is defined in your php.ini. Why don't browser DNS caches mitigate DDOS attacks on DNS providers? Nginx Php Error Log Join them; it only takes a minute: Sign up Where does PHP store the error log? (php5, apache, fastcgi, cpanel) up vote 204 down vote favorite 45 I am on shared

But when problems do occur (as they invariably do), your error logs should be one of the first stops you make on your debugging trail. It pays almost no attention to security and performance and shouldn’t be used as-is in any “real” environment. composer create-project symfony/framework-standard-edition my "2.6.*" This quickly gives us a working test project with a nice UI. http://back2cloud.com/error-log/php-log-error-location.php extra_headers The extra headers.

php logging centos suphp

There are also numerous logging libraries for the PHP developer, such as Monolog (popular among Symfony and Laravel users), as well as various framework-specific implementations, such as the logging capabilities incorporated Accordingly: # grep "DISPATCH TIME" info.log | grep -cE "\s[0-9]{2,}\.|\s[5-9]\." 2 Answer: 20% (i.e., 2/10) Did anyone ever supply GET parameters? # grep URI info.log | grep \?

Your virtual host could override it then with ErrorLog "/path/to/error_log". Modify NTFS security permissions of the directory
"C:\php" to give Read and Execute permissions to (1) the
IIS Guest Account and (2) the group IIS_WPG.
7. You might want to check with your host if the main PHP mail() function is disabled on your server. One for your browser and IDE and the other for viewing the log files update live as you go. up down 18 roychri at php dot net ¶6 years ago

